In fact, I think we bumped into each other there at some point. I'm interested in whether Bourdieu has a realist ontology underpinning his approach as I'm undecided as yet. He seems to move back and forth between weak forms of social constructionism and weak forms of realism. Clarity in my mind isn't helped by his claims to do x, y, z which I then find repeated in commentaries, and his use of the word 'science' without that clear a definition.
